Output 30994cb6963977ad208c2083b154e818431e70ca64256216801e20a2e99067dc:170

value
160576560
script pubkey
OP_0 OP_PUSHBYTES_20 ca5dca1201e4d6a630c30f4f7fbf094ab4e25fba
address
bc1qefwu5yspunt2vvxrpa8hl0cff26wyha6vlj8ru
transaction
30994cb6963977ad208c2083b154e818431e70ca64256216801e20a2e99067dc
spent
true